A reassuring buzz came from the guitar as I plugged it into one of the any amplifiers and I tested the strings: perfect... I glanced around the room. At the three other people; James, who gave me a friendly thumbs-up, and two technicians. They were all waiting expectantly for what was in store for them. Taking a deep breath, I held my fingers to the guitar neck, readied my voice, and began to play.
As I finished my second song, James burst into my half of the soundproof room and patted me firmly on the back. 'That's my boy!'
I grinned sheepishly, still clutching my beloved guitar in my calloused hands. The thick door was still open and I noticed the technicians applauding admiringly. I bowed jokingly, attempting to hide my obvious smile. Both technicians walked in, and one shook my hand vigorously.
'Alright! Hello Mr. White! My name is Michael and as you can probably tell, I am one of the technicians here at Black Raven Records! And this is my partner in all-things-technical, Liam.'
Liam waved, smiling.
'They were some impressive tunes! No, not impressive, extremely impressive!,' Liam complimented.
James chuckled 'Okay guys so flattery over. We need to record some more and then tonight we can take it to the boss. So 'Mr White', what do you say? You ready?'.
'Of course I'm ready James. I'll always be ready. Oh, and call me Charlie!' I winked.
After getting our top-notch recording equipment prepared again, I entered my recording half of the room and practiced my singing and guitar. After a minute of two, I was ready.
'We good to go?' Asked Michael, his finger hovering over a button, and his whole other hand fixed on several dials and switches.
'Yep, let's go!'
Now I only had one worry. James had mentioned about showing some of my music to 'The Boss' later. I just hoped upon hoped that he would understand...
